Ruling in e-books class action is blow to defense in DOJ antitrust suit

5/16/2012

Apple, Penguin, and Macmillan -- the remaining defendants in the Justice Department’s suit alleging an illegal antitrust conspiracy in the e-books market -- have to be mighty discouraged by U.S. District Judge Denise Cote’s ruling Tuesday in the parallel class action. Cote, who is also overseeing the DOJ case, makes short work of all the defenses Apple and the publishers might raise.
